Castlecary, standing on the watershed of Scotland`s central belt and on the shortest route between Forth and Clyde as the Romans realised when they built their Antonine Wall, is uniquely placed to cater for all business travel and will also please guests who simply wish to relax and enjoy Scotland.
A Scottish Tourist Board 3-Star rated hotel with 70 comfortable rooms, our accommodation uniquely comprises of mainly cottages surrounding the main building.
We pride ourselves on being able to combine great homemade food, good service and the informality and friendliness of a family run hotel.
